When members of the Pittsburgh Steelers came together for a Bible study Saturday night in New York City, they ended up meeting a surprise guest: pop star Justin Bieber.
At least three players — backup quarterback Brad Gradkowski, linebacker Arthur Moats and defensive end Cam Heyward — tweeted about Bieber's presence at the Christian study, according to the Huffington Post.

Sports Illustrated speculated that Bieber was staying at the same New York City hotel as the Steelers, who were in town to play the Jets on Sunday (the Jets ended up winning the game 20 to 13).
It's not entirely surprising that Bieber would attend Bible study, as he has repeatedly said publicly that he is a Christian.
